Quote:
Originally Posted by htismaqe View Post
Hitchens has a history as a solid coverage backer, going all the way back to college. I'm not worried about Hitchens at all. He didn't play all pre-season and he came from a Marinelli defense. He's going to get better as he adjusts to scheme.
I am a big big fan of Hitchens. Right now he's showing himself to be game if nothing else; he's not going to shy away from anything. So hopefully he starts getting more comfortable in the scheme.

We were spoiled by DJ - a true All-Pro 3-down linebacker ain't walking through that door again for a long while, gents. When TG left, we got damn lucky to find Kelce. And our history with RBs seems similar - we just keep bouncing from pro bowler to pro bowler.

But I don't think we can expect that kind of thing at ILB. We need to adjust to a normal life here - most interior linebackers can't cover like a safety and we just have to deal with that.
